Bacon and Egg Breakfast Pizza
Start your day with a twist on the classic breakfast combo: crispy bacon, scrambled eggs, and melted mozzarella on a buttery pizza crust. This hearty breakfast pizza is perfect for a weekend brunch or a quick morning pick-me-up.

Ingredients:

– 1 pre-made pizza crust
– 6 slices of cooked bacon
– 2 large eggs
– 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2. Roll out the pizza crust and place on a baking sheet.
3. Cook the bacon until crispy, then chop into small pieces.
4. Scramble the eggs in a bowl and set aside.
5. Spread the scrambled eggs over the pizza crust, leaving a small border around the edges.
6. Top the eggs with the chopped bacon, mozzarella cheese, and salt to taste.
7.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until the crust is golden brown and the cheese is melted.
8. Garnish with chopped parsley, if desired.

Cooking Time: 12-15 minutes

Sausage Gravy Breakfast Pizza
Sausage Gravy Breakfast Pizza Recipe

Get ready to start your day off right with this savory breakfast pizza that combines the flavors of sausage gravy, scrambled eggs, and melted mozzarella cheese on a crispy crust.

Ingredients:

– 1 pre-made pizza crust (homemade or store-bought)
– 1 lb sweet Italian sausage, casings removed
– 2 large eggs
– 1/4 cup heavy cream
– 2 tbsp butter
– 1 tsp dried oregano
– 8 oz shredded mozzarella c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. Cook the sausage in a large skillet over medium-high heat, breaking it up with a spoon as it cooks, until browned and cooked through.
3. Remove the sausage from the skillet with a slotted spoon, leaving the drippings behind. Pour off any excess fat.
4. Add the butter, heavy cream, and oregano to the skillet and stir to combine. Bring to a simmer.
5. Scramble in the eggs until they’re cooked through. Stir in the cooked sausage.
6. Roll out the pizza crust on a lightly floured surface to desired thickness.
7. Top the crust with the egg and sausage mixture, then sprinkle with mozzarella cheese.
8.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until the crust is golden brown and the cheese is melted.

Hash Brown Crust Breakfast Pizza
Elevate your breakfast game with this innovative recipe that combines the comfort of hash browns with the fun of a pizza. The result is a crispy, golden crust topped with creamy eggs and melted cheese.

Ingredients:

– 2 large potatoes, peeled
– 1/4 cup grated cheddar cheese
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 1/2 teaspoon salt
– 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– 2 eggs
– Shredded mozzarella cheese (for topping)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2. Grate the potatoes and squeeze out excess moisture.
3. In a bowl, mix together grated potatoes, cheddar cheese, parsley, salt, and pepper.
4. Shape the mixture into a circle or rectangle, about 1/4 inch thick.
5. Brush the hash brown crust with olive oil and b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den.
6. Crack in eggs and cook until set.
7. Top with shredded mozzarella cheese and return to oven for an additional 2-3 minutes or until melted.

Cooking Time: 35-40 minutes

Breakfast Pizza with Sausage and Peppers
Start your day off right with this savory breakfast pizza, loaded with spicy sausage, colorful peppers, and melted mozzarella cheese. A flavorful twist on the classic breakfast sandwich!

Ingredients:

– 1 pre-made pizza crust or 1 package of pizza dough
– 1 pound sweet Italian sausage, casings removed
– 2 large bell peppers (any color), sliced
– 1 medium onion, thinly sliced
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Fresh parsley,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. Cook sausage in a large skillet over medium-high heat, breaking apart with a spoon, until browned and cooked through.
3. Add sliced peppers and onion to the skillet; cook until tender.
4. Roll out pizza dough or warm pre-made crust according to package instructions.
5. Spread sausage and pepper mixture evenly over the dough.
6. Sprinkle mozzarella cheese on top.
7.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until crust is golden brown and cheese is melted.

Cooking Time: 15 minutes

Breakfast Pizza with Goat Cheese and Arugula
A twist on the classic pizza, this breakfast version combines creamy goat cheese, peppery arugula, and a flaky crust for a delicious morning treat.

Ingredients:

– 1 pre-made pizza crust or 1 package of crescent roll dough
– 2 tablespoons goat cheese, crumbled
– 1/4 cup arugula leaves
– 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Optional toppings: cherry tomatoes, sliced bell peppers, spinach

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2. Roll out pizza crust or unroll crescent roll dough.
3. Spread goat cheese evenly over the crust, leaving a small border around edges.
4. Top with arugula leaves and sprinkle with salt and pepper to taste.
5. Create an egg wash by beating the egg and brushing it gently over the crust to give it a golden glaze.
6. Place pizza on a ba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until crust is golden brown and goat cheese is melted.
7. Remove from oven and let cool for 2-3 minutes before serving.

Cooking Time: 15-20 minutes

Breakfast Pizza with Mushrooms and Gruyere
Start your day with a flavorful twist on traditional breakfast, featuring sautéed mushrooms and melted Gruyère cheese atop a crispy pizza crust.

Ingredients:

– 1 lb pizza dough (homemade or store-bought)
– 2 cups mixed mushrooms (button, cremini, shiitake), sliced
– 1/4 cup unsalted butter, divided
– 1 medium onion, finely chopped
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 tsp dried thyme
– Salt and pepper, to taste
– 8 oz Gruyère cheese, shredded
– 2 large eggs, beaten
– Fresh parsley,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Roll out pizza dough to a thickness of about 1/4 inch.
2. In a skillet, sauté mushrooms and onion in 1 tablespoon butter until tender. Add garlic, thyme, salt, and pepper; cook for an additional minute.
3. Place the pizza crust on a baking sheet or pizza stone. Top with mushroom mixture, leaving a 1/2-inch border around the edges.
4. Sprinkle Gruyère cheese evenly over the mushrooms. Beat eggs in a small bowl and brush the edges of the crust with the egg wash.
5.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until crust is golden brown and cheese is melted.
